Tennessee Knights of Columbus Presents Annual Bishop’s Burse
Tennessee Knights of Columbus Presents Annual Bishop’s Burse Knights of Columbus Tennessee State Deputy, Michael McCusker, recently presented a check to Bishop David P. Talley for the Annual Bishop’s Burse. The amount represents contributions from all 96 active KofC Councils in Tennessee comprised of 12,000 Brother Knights.
